The Importance of Authentication and Value
Let's talk brass tacks: value. The value of items in the Derek Jeter Signature Series can vary significantly, depending on rarity, condition, and the item itself. A signed game-used bat, for instance, will likely fetch a higher price than a signed photo. That's why it's super important to understand the market and do your research. Authentication is your best friend when it comes to value. A COA from a trusted source is not just a piece of paper; it's your assurance that the item is genuine and worth the price. Without it, you're essentially taking a gamble. You'll find a lot of different kinds of items in the series, so there's really something for everyone. Another thing that affects value is the item's condition. A mint-condition jersey or baseball is going to be worth much more than one that's worn or damaged. And of course, there's the signature itself. How clear and bold is it? Is it in a good spot on the item? These are all factors that can influence value. Finally, understanding the market trends is also super important. What's hot right now? What items are rare? What's going on with the overall demand for Derek Jeter memorabilia? Staying informed will help you make smarter collecting decisions and protect your investment. Keep your eyes peeled for limited-edition items too, because these are usually the most sought after.

Signed Baseballs and Bats
Starting with the classics: signed baseballs and bats. These are the cornerstones of any good collection. A baseball signed by Jeter is an iconic item, representing one of his 3,465 hits in his career. The value of these baseballs can vary widely, depending on the condition of the ball, the signature itself (a clean, bold signature is always preferred), and whether it's a special edition. A game-used baseball, of course, is a home run in terms of value. Bats are also incredibly popular. A bat signed by Jeter could be from a specific season, or even a bat he used to break a record. A game-used bat is the holy grail for collectors, and can be quite an investment. The thing with bats is that condition matters. So make sure the bat is in good shape.

Preserving Your Derek Jeter Collection
So, you've got your items. Now what? Preserving your collection is just as important as building it. Here are a few essential tips to keep your treasures in tip-top shape. This is super important!
Storage Solutions
- First, protect your items from the elements. Display cases are super handy. Make sure they are acid-free, UV-resistant, and archival-quality. This is important.
- Store your items in a cool, dark, and dry place. Avoid attics, basements, or garages where temperature and humidity can fluctuate wildly.
Display and Handling
- When displaying your items, use proper lighting. Avoid direct sunlight, which can fade colors and damage signatures. LED lighting is a great option. It’s cool and energy-efficient.
- Handle your items with clean hands and consider using gloves. Even the oils from your skin can damage delicate items. Always be gentle.
Insurance and Documentation
- Consider insuring your collection. Memorabilia can be a valuable investment, so protect it. Get it insured. Document your collection, including photos, COAs, and purchase records. This is super important, especially if you have a lot of items!
